Using the Operation Commands Table
RS232 Control 9
Command Types Allowed
Use only the types listed in the first column.
Note: Any word or character or phrase that appears between [square brackets] is for
information or clarification only. It is not sent to the tile or received from it.
Symbol Meaning Example Result
= Set tells the tile to
take the value
that follows
op A* white.balance (all) = 100
[CR]
All tiles with a Group ID
of A (and Unit ID of
anything) will set their
white balance levels for
red, green and blue to
their maximum of 100
? Get asks for the
value
op A1 contrast ? [CR]
Tells tile A1to send the
value of contrast to the
host computer. Note
that the tile will only
respond if it is addressed
individually.
+ Increment increments the
value
op ** gray.balance(red) + [CR]
Makes all the tiles
increase their Gray
Balance value by one.
Note that any tile whose
value is already at the
top (in this case 15) will
not increase it.
Decrement decrements the
value
op ** white.balance(green) – [CR]
Makes all the tiles
decrease their White
Balance value by one.
Any tile that had a white
balance of 1 before the
decrement will not
change.
[none] Execute means the
command is
executed. No
character
follows the
command (or
the Target, if it
has one)
op ** slot.save (0) – [CR]
Saves slot 1 to memory.
